Understanding the Basics of Paving Stones
Paving stones are a popular choice for various outdoor surfaces, including driveways, patios, and walkways. They come in a wide range of materials, sizes, shapes, and textures, each offering unique aesthetic and functional benefits. Common materials used for paving stones include concrete, natural stone (such as granite, limestone, and sandstone), and brick.
The process of splitting paving stones involves dividing a larger stone or slab into smaller, more manageable pieces. This can be necessary for various reasons, such as fitting the stones into a specific layout, creating custom shapes, or achieving a particular aesthetic effect.

Considerations for Splitting Paving Stones
While a stone splitter can be a highly effective tool for splitting paving stones, several factors need to be considered to ensure successful and safe operation.
Stone Material
Different types of stone have varying hardness, density, and brittleness, which can affect the splitting process. For example, granite is a hard and dense stone that requires more force to split, while limestone is relatively softer and more prone to chipping. It's essential to choose the appropriate stone splitter and settings based on the specific material you're working with.
Stone Thickness and Size
The thickness and size of the paving stones also play a crucial role in determining the suitability of a stone splitter. Thicker stones may require more powerful equipment, while larger stones may need to be split in multiple passes or sections. Additionally, the size of the stone splitter's work area should be considered to ensure that it can accommodate the stones you're working with.
Safety Precautions
Working with a stone splitter involves handling heavy machinery and sharp tools, which can pose significant safety risks if not used properly. It's essential to follow all safety guidelines and procedures provided by the manufacturer, including wearing appropriate personal protective equipment (PPE), such as safety glasses, gloves, and ear protection. Additionally, the work area should be clear of any obstacles or debris, and the stone splitter should be properly maintained and inspected regularly.
